Method

For the Gazpacho

  1. 1

    Prepare the Ingredients

    Wash the tomatoes, cucumber, bell pepper, and red onion. Cut them into large chunks.

  2. 2

    Blend the Gazpacho

    In a blender, combine the tomatoes, cucumber, red bell pepper, red onion, and garlic cloves. Blend until smooth.

  3. 3

    Add Seasoning

    Add olive oil, red wine vinegar, salt, and black pepper to the blended mixture. Blend again until well combined.

  4. 4

    Chill the Gazpacho

    Transfer the gazpacho to a bowl or pitcher and refrigerate for at least 1 hour to allow flavors to meld.

  5. 5

    Serve

    Serve the chilled gazpacho in bowls, garnished with fresh basil.

For the Grilled Spanish Flatbread (Coca)

  1. 6

    Activate the Yeast

    In a bowl, mix the warm water and yeast. Let it sit for about 5 minutes until frothy.

  2. 7

    Make the Dough

    In a large bowl, combine flour and salt. Add the yeast mixture and olive oil. Mix until a dough forms.

  3. 8

    Knead the Dough

    Turn the dough onto a floured surface and knead for about 5-7 minutes until smooth and elastic.

  4. 9

    Let the Dough Rise

    Place the dough in a greased bowl, cover it with a damp cloth, and let it rise in a warm place for about 1 hour or until doubled in size.

  5. 10

    Shape and Grill the Flatbread

    Preheat the grill. Divide the dough into portions and roll each into a flat, oval shape. Grill for 3-4 minutes on each side until golden and cooked through.

  6. 11

    Add Optional Toppings

    If desired, top the grilled flatbreads with olives, tomatoes, or onions before serving.

  7. 12

    Serve

    Serve the grilled Spanish flatbread warm alongside the chilled gazpacho.
